package certmagic
import (
"context"
"errors"
"net/http"
"net/http/httptest"
"os"
"testing"
"go.uber.org/zap"
"go.uber.org/zap/zapcore"
"go.uber.org/zap/zaptest/observer"
)
type loadResultStorage struct {
Storage
data []byte
err error
}
func (s loadResultStorage) Load(context.Context, string) ([]byte, error) {
return s.data, s.err
}
func TestHTTPChallengeHandlerNoOp(t *testing.T) {
am := &ACMEIssuer{CA: "https://example.com/acme/directory", Logger: defaultTestLogger}
testConfig := &Config{
Issuers: []Issuer{am},
Storage: &FileStorage{Path: "./_testdata_tmp"},
Logger: defaultTestLogger,
certCache: new(Cache),
}
am.config = testConfig
testStorageDir := testConfig.Storage.(*FileStorage).Path
defer func() {
err := os.RemoveAll(testStorageDir)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Could not remove temporary storage directory (%s): %v", testStorageDir, err)
}
}()
// try base paths and host names that aren't
// handled by this handler
for _, url := range []string{
"http://localhost/",
"http://localhost/foo.html",
"http://localhost/.git",
"http://localhost/.well-known/",
"http://localhost/.well-known/acme-challenging",
"http://other/.well-known/acme-challenge/foo",
} {
req, err := http.NewRequest("GET", url, nil)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("Could not craft request, got error: %v", err)
}
rw := httptest.NewRecorder()
if am.HandleHTTPChallenge(rw, req) {
t.Errorf("Got true with this URL, but shouldn't have: %s", url)
}
}
}
func TestHTTPChallengeLookupLogLevel(t *testing.T) {
tests := []struct {
name string
storage Storage
cancelRequest bool
wantLevel zapcore.Level
}{
{
name: "no active challenge",
storage: &memoryStorage{},
wantLevel: zap.DebugLevel,
},
{
name: "empty challenge data",
storage: loadResultStorage{
Storage: &memoryStorage{},
data: []byte{},
},
wantLevel: zap.WarnLevel,
},
{
name: "request canceled",
storage: loadResultStorage{
Storage: &memoryStorage{},
err: context.Canceled,
},
cancelRequest: true,
wantLevel: zap.DebugLevel,
},
{
name: "storage operation canceled",
storage: loadResultStorage{
Storage: &memoryStorage{},
err: context.Canceled,
},
wantLevel: zap.WarnLevel,
},
{
name: "storage failure",
storage: loadResultStorage{
Storage: &memoryStorage{},
err: errors.New("storage unavailable"),
},
wantLevel: zap.WarnLevel,
},
}
for _, tt := range tests {
t.Run(tt.name, func(t *testing.T) {
core, logs := observer.New(zap.DebugLevel)
logger := zap.New(core)
am := &ACMEIssuer{
CA: "https://example.com/acme/directory",
Logger: logger,
}
am.config = &Config{
Issuers: []Issuer{am},
Storage: tt.storage,
Logger: logger,
}
req := httptest.NewRequest(
http.MethodGet,
"http://example.com/.well-known/acme-challenge/token",
nil,
)
if tt.cancelRequest {
ctx, cancel := context.WithCancel(req.Context())
cancel()
req = req.WithContext(ctx)
}
if am.HandleHTTPChallenge(httptest.NewRecorder(), req) {
t.Fatal("expected challenge request not to be handled")
}
entries := logs.FilterMessage("looking up info for HTTP challenge").All()
if len(entries) != 1 {
t.Fatalf("expected one challenge lookup log, got %d", len(entries))
}
if entries[0].Level != tt.wantLevel {
t.Fatalf("expected log level %s, got %s", tt.wantLevel, entries[0].Level)
}
})
}
}
